Output 0d632580b75dd79d624ff031c91c0fcc30bbd547a8ba0ee4d0bc150fa0d92426:0

value
18239083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3b65954855254bc0526390f218d83daf8d9e510 OP_EQUAL
address
3KXr8n3z9eLHh4DRyeKoQovBjRTkWa9MEh
transaction
0d632580b75dd79d624ff031c91c0fcc30bbd547a8ba0ee4d0bc150fa0d92426
spent
true